(VOVWORLD) -The United States is Vietnam's second largest trading partner, largest export market in 2022 and a potential market for Vietnamese exports, said Commercial Counsellor in the US Do Ngoc Hung.

Hung told a Voice of Vietnam reporter based in Washington DC that Vietnam's exports to the US in 11 months of 2022 reached 101.2 billion USD, accounting for about 30% of Vietnam's total export turnover. This marks the first time that Vietnam's exports to a country have topped 100 billion USD. Imports from this market totaled 13.5 billion USD.

The Commercial Counsellor elaborated on the prospect of trade between Vietnam and the US, saying “We have grounds to believe that in 2023 we can expect the two-way trade turnover to continue to exceed 100 billion USD."

"However, advantages and disadvantages, opportunities and challenges always go together. In addition to the support of state management agencies for industry associations and businesses, the smooth coordination between businesses and associations, localities as well as between businesses will help enterprises actively adapt and improve production capacity and competitiveness,” he added. 

Hung suggested that Vietnamese enterprises exporting to the US pay more attention to the origin of goods and origin of raw materials.
